Irradiation of human blood is used to avoid the TA-GVHD (transfusion-associated graft-versus-host-disease), a rare but devastating adverse effect of leukocytes present in blood component for immunocompetent transfusion recipients.It is worth noting that cesium and X-ray irradiators are devices dedicated to blood irradiation, usually operated by specialized institutions or departments external to the healthcare facilities that are actually using the irradiated blood (and thus have to purchase it from the irradiation service providers); in contrast, many user facilities already have LINACs and cobalt sources for cancer therapy and other treatments. These units, although they are designed for other purposes, can be used for blood irradiation on a limited basis. For example, a blood bag holder can be placed where a patient would be exposed and the LINAC operated to irradiate the blood instead of a person.
